  1. Accept One Another Romans 15:7-13

  2. HOW We Unite For just as we have many members in one body and all the members do not have the same function, so we, who are many, are one body in Christ, and individually members one of another. Romans 12.4-5

  3. HOW We Unite Let love be without hypocrisy. Abhor what is evil; cling to what is good. Be devoted to one another in brotherly love; give preference to one another in honor; Romans 12.9-10

  4. HOW We Unite So then we pursue the things which make for peace and the building up of one another. Romans 14.19

  5. WHY We Unite Therefore, accept one another, just as Christ also accepted us to the glory of God. Romans 15.7

  6. WHY We Unite Now may the God who gives perseverance and encouragement grant you to be of the same mind with one another according to Christ Jesus, so that with one accord you may with one voice glorify the God and Father of our Lord Jesus Christ. Romans 15.5-6

  7. HOW God is GLORIFIED For I say that Christ has become a servant to the circumcision on behalf of the truth of God to confirm the promises given to the fathers, and for the Gentiles to glorify God for His mercy; Romans 15.8-9a

  8. HOW God is GLORIFIED “THEREFORE I WILL GIVE PRAISE TO YOU AMONG THE GENTILES, AND I WILL SING TO YOUR NAME.” David - Psalm 18

  9. HOW God is GLORIFIED “REJOICE, O GENTILES, WITH HIS PEOPLE.” Moses - Deuteronomy 32

  10. HOW God is GLORIFIED “THERE SHALL COME THE ROOT OF JESSE, AND HE WHO ARISES TO RULE OVER THE GENTILES, IN HIM SHALL THE GENTILES HOPE.” Isaiah – Isaiah 11

  11. We are united in HOPE Now may the God of hope fill you with all joy and peace in believing, so that you will abound in hope by the power of the Holy Spirit. Romans 15.13

  12. Application Increase in UNITY Increase in HOPE
